Tenore Primo

I was under the understanding that Entourage would put emails into my
"Inbox" from people whose email address was in the Entourage address
book. However, sometimes this doesn't happen. Some are put in the
"Deleted Items" folder. I have no filters set, so it can't be that.
Please enlighten me.

You must have a rule that is moving the message. The most likely culprit is
the Mailing List Manager - it's too easy to set up a MLM rule by accident,
when you are marking a message as 'not junk' - the wording of that dialog is
ambiguous to say the least. Check if there is an MLM entry (look for MLM
entries under the tools menu) with the Deleted Items folder as the target
folder. If there is, delete it and all should be back to normal.

FWIW....There are three types of rules used in Entourage to manage your
mail. The Mailing List Manager (MLM) and Junk Mail Filter (JMF) are names
for specialized rules. Rules are custom rules that you create.
